Well, in the general Shazam origin story which Alex Ross may have explored artistically, Billy Batson is a good - hearted kid. He gets the power of Shazam which gives him the wisdom of Solomon, the strength of Hercules, the stamina of Atlas, the power of Zeus, the courage of Achilles, and the speed of Mercury. Shazam's back story is that he was originally a young boy named Billy Batson. He was given the power to transform into a super - hero by an ancient wizard. When he says the word 'Shazam', he is struck by magic lightning and turns into a powerful adult with various super - abilities like super - strength, flight, and lightning powers.
